Role Responsibility
As a qualified Chef, you will be responsible for the preparation, cooking and storing of all foods within Montgomery kitchen and ensuring the quality of the product complies with Sodexo’s standards at all times as well as meeting food safety and health & safety regulations. There will also be occasions where you will be expected to support other departments within the company at a variety of functions from barbecues to gala balls.
As a Head Chef, you will be expected to take responsibility for the day to day management of your kitchen. You will be required to ensure that all levels of the SSS are delivered on a daily basis. This will include inventory management, people management/development, customer service and all key aspects required to deliver a large contract catering offer in line with the client’s expectations.

About the Company
In the UK and Ireland, Sodexo employs some 35,000 employees to deliver integrated facilities management services to clients at over 2,000 locations in the corporate, healthcare, education, leisure, defence and justice sectors. With an annual turnover of over £1bn, we provide everything from catering, cleaning and reception to security, laboratory and grounds maintenance services, enabling our clients to focus on their core business
